Uniden's APCO-25 Capable portable Trunktracker IV Scanner with Dynamic Memory Architecture.


Specifications

Physical

  • Antenna Uniden # BATG0469001
  • Antenna Connector: SMA (w/BNC adapter)
  • Battery level display
  • Blue LCD and Keypad Backlight
  • Compatible with BC-RH96 Remote Head
  • PC Programming and Control
  • Signal Strength display
  • Strong signal attenuation

Keys

  • Group Quick Key range: 0-9
  • System Quick Key range: 0-99

Technical

  • Channels: 6000 maximum
  • Custom Search Ranges: 10
  • Groups per system: 20 maximum
  • Preprogrammed Service Search Bands: 12
  • Scan Rate: 100 channels per second (conventional mode)
  • 12 Service Searches - Public Safety, News, HAM Radio, Marine, Railroad, Air, CB Radio, FRS/GMRS, Racing, FM Broadcast, TV Broadcast, and Special (Itinerant)
  • Supported step sizes: 5, 6.25, 7.5, 8.33, 10, 12.5,15, 20, 25, 50 or 100 kHz.
  • Systems: 400 maximum
  • Talkgroups per trunked system: 200 maximum
  • 16 character text tagging for each system, group, channel, talkgroup, search range, Tone-out, and SAME group

Frequency Coverage

North American Model BCD396T
  • 25.0000 - 512.0000 MHz
  • 764.0000 - 775.9875 MHz
  • 794.0000 - 823.9875 MHz
  • 849.0125 - 868.9875 MHz
  • 894.0125 - 956.0000 MHz
  • 1240.0000 - 1300.0000 MHz
Australia/New Zealand Model UBCD396T
  • 25.0000 - 512.0000 MHz
  • 764.0000 - 775.9875 MHz
  • 794.0000 - 956.0000 MHz
  • 1240.0000 - 1300.0000 MHz

RR System Compatibility

This scanner is compatible with the following Trunking System Types and System Voices used in the RadioReference Database, of course you must verify that the scanner will cover the appropriate frequency range:

  • System Types:
    • Motorola Type I
    • Motorola Type II
    • Motorola Type IIi Hybrid
    • Motorola Type II Smartnet
    • Motorola Type II Smartzone
    • Motorola Type II Smartzone Omnilink
    • Motorola Type II VOC
    • EDACS Standard (Wide)
    • EDACS Standard Networked
    • EDACS Narrowband (Narrow)
    • EDACS Narrowband Networked
    • EDACS SCAT
    • EDACS ESK (version 3.0 firmware or later required)
    • LTR Standard
    • Project 25 Standard
  • System Voices:
    • Analog
    • Analog and APCO-25 Common Air Interface
    • APCO-25 Common Air Interface Exclusive
